Description

No. 34 on West Street is likely from the 17th century. It is a two-storey building made of stone, topped with a stone slate roof. The front features three windows, which are modern sliding sashes with glazing bars, and a canted bay with four lights. There is also an entry for a garage. This property is part of a group that includes Nos. 2 to 36 (even) and 42 to 46A (even) and 52 to 98 (even).
